Product Notes
The Beastie Boys are among the most influential groups of the last two decades. As their music has opened hip-hop to a wider audience and changed the parameters of it's sound, their ambitious music videos have carried the medium to new levels of artistic expression. This groundbreaking anthology showcases the vast potential of technology, with most of the eighteen videos containing alternate visual angles and multiple audio tracks. There are hundreds of possible image and sound combinations, including new surround mixes, versions, instrumentals, and more than 40 remixes (by such artists as Moby, Fatboy Slim and the Prunes), including many new remixes created exclusively for this release. Loaded with never-before-seen footage and unreleased music tracks, this also contains a trove of rare still photos and exclusive audio commentary by the band and the video directors. And the coup de grace; the world-premiere director's cut of Nathanial Hornblower's INTERGALACTIC spin-off THE ROBOT VS. THE OCTOPUS MONSTER SAGA.
